CVE-2023-43194: CVE-2023-43194: Submitty Incorrect Access Control Vulnerability Report

Submitty before v22.06.00 is vulnerable to Incorrect Access Control. An attacker can delete any post in the forum by modifying request parameter.

CVE-2023-31579: JWTissues/lamp issue.md at main · xubowenW/JWTissues

Dromara Lamp-Cloud before v3.8.1 was discovered to use a hardcoded cryptographic key when creating and verifying a Json Web Token. This vulnerability allows attackers to authenticate to the application via a crafted JWT token.

Russian Reshipping Service ‘SWAT USA Drop’ Exposed

One of the largest cybercrime services for laundering stolen merchandise was hacked recently, exposing its internal operations, finances and organizational structure. Here’s a closer look at the Russia-based SWAT USA Drop Service, which currently employs more than 1,200 people across the United States who are knowingly or unwittingly involved in reshipping expensive consumer goods purchased with stolen credit cards.

CVE-2023-31027: NVIDIA Support

NVIDIA GPU Display Driver for Windows contains a vulnerability that allows Windows users with low levels of privilege to escalate privileges when an administrator is updating GPU drivers, which may lead to escalation of privileges.

CVE-2023-5846

Franklin Fueling System TS-550 versions prior to 1.9.23.8960 are vulnerable to attackers decoding admin credentials, resulting in unauthenticated access to the device.

CVE-2023-5035: PT-G503 Series Multiple Vulnerabilities

A vulnerability has been identified in PT-G503 Series firmware versions prior to v5.2, where the Secure attribute for sensitive cookies in HTTPS sessions is not set, which could cause the cookie to be transmitted in plaintext over an HTTP session. The vulnerability may lead to security risks, potentially exposing user session data to unauthorized access and manipulation.

CVE-2023-42802: Release 10.0.10 · glpi-project/glpi

GLPI is a free asset and IT management software package. Starting in version 10.0.7 and prior to version 10.0.10, an unverified object instantiation allows one to upload malicious PHP files to unwanted directories. Depending on web server configuration and available system libraries, malicious PHP files can then be executed through a web server request. Version 10.0.10 fixes this issue. As a workaround, remove write access on `/ajax` and `/front` files to the web server.
